The name says it all: This is the cookbook for anyone with a busy life and a tight budget. In today's world it is easy to find yourself short on time and money. Cooking for your family while working fulltime seems nearly impossible. But Gill Holcombe proves that with healthy ingredients and stress-free recipes you can feed your family of four for less that $45 a week. Filled with simple, wholesome and nutritious recipes, this brilliant little cookbook will save you from spending hours slaving over a hot stove or spending a fortune at the supermarket. It is a must-have kitchen companion for the modern family. How to Feed Your Whole Family includes: · Over 200 recipes for all types of meals · Straightforward ingredients list · Clear instructions and advice · Updated weekly shopping lists · Budget-friendly menu plans.

Complete Family Nutrition is a one-stop visual guide to the best, most balanced diet for every family member. Whatever your needs, this book is like visiting your very own nutritionist. Written by trusted nutritionist Jane Clarke, this book guides parents on healthy food choices for their families, using tailored advice for every age group, from infants to adults. From essential nutrients to ideal serving size, this book explains how nutrition can promote healthy weight, optimal memory, growth and development, digestive health, and balanced moods, and provides nutritious, healthy recipes to help any family achieve this.
